P.E. Curriculum Comes to Life on Fishing Expedition
Fourth-graders at Glenridge Elementary put their fishing skills to the test on May 19 during the school’s annual fourth-grade fishing field trip in Forest Park. The students took part in the fishing expedition in conjunction with the fourth-grade physical education curriculum. Students practiced their casting skills during P.E. class at Glenridge in preparation for the field trip.
The Missouri Department of Conservation stocked the three “learning lakes” in Forest Park with fish to ensure students would have a greater likelihood of being successful on their catch-and-release fishing trip. And the trip was, indeed, a success. All of the fourth-graders were able to catch at least one fish.

In addition to P.E. Teachers Steve Hutson and Nicole Miller, the Glenridge fourth-grade teachers and several parent volunteers accompanied the students on their fishing expedition.
